Meet the Hotel Industry’s Most Influential People at INSPIRE22

December 6, 2022 By admin Leave a Comment

PALM BEACH GARDENS, Fla., Dec. 6, 2022 – The International Luxury Hotel Association will hold its 11th annual INSPIRE22 conference on December 14&15 at the Arizona Biltmore with Bill Walshe, CEO, Viceroy Hotel Group opening the event with a keynote on Lodging Leadership 2.0 – Prepare to Pivot. Shelly Murphy, Founder & Managing Director Atari Hotels, will talk about her new project with Gensler in Las Vegas, Atari Hotels, inspired by gaming culture and driven by the desire to play.

The Regency Group is sponsoring a panel on Creating a Brand Story – From Concept to Implementation, taking an in-depth view of the vision behind the brand concept, positioning, creation and launch. Speakers include Jaclyn Riley, Vice President Brand Marketing, Ennismore, Tiffany Cooper, Head of Development, Kimpton Hotels & Resorts, Jennifer Barnwell, President, Curator Hotel & Resort Collection and Yossi Loeb, CEO, the Regency Group with Lisa Cain, Associate Professor, Florida International University moderating.

Regency Group is also printing the conference brochure, which will include Spotlight On interviews from Luxury Hoteliers magazine with hoteliers like Benoit Racle, Vice President, Global Brand Management, W Hotels & Resorts, Rika Lisslö, Vice President, Hyatt Hotels Corporation and Dave Tessier, Founder & CEO, Hospitality Gaming Advisors.

The Inspire networking hub will run parallel to the speaking sessions and extended lunches include roundtable discussions with leaders in luxury hospitality, where attendees can join the conversation.

About the International Luxury Hotel Association
The International Luxury Hotel Association is the luxury hospitality’s preeminent association promoting, unifying and advancing the industry through insight, opinion and research.

ILHA reaches an audience of more than 500,000 hotel professionals in 90+ countries and produces LUXURY HOTELIERS Magazine, ILHA SmartBrief and the INSPIRE SUMMITS in Europe and North America. They also run LinkedIn’s largest hospitality and travel group which ranks in the top 100 of the more than 10 million professional groups on LinkedIn.
